St. Louis Senior Portrait Photographer | Amy’s Album

I love when clients book me to do a senior photo shoot that will end result in an album. Knowing ahead of time what you want can assist me in the shooting process. I can then visualize what your album layout would be like and create consistent photos that work well together in a nice layout. I tend to be more of the simple, clean layout designer. Graphic/digitally produced albums aren’t always my thing, but I’ll do them if requested. They take more time and I think tend to look a little more outdated faster in the future years.

This album is a 7 x 7 album with 28 pages. An album is a great way to get all your photos from your session in a beautifully presented way. You aren’t committed to hanging them all on the wall if that’s your fear. But, the best thing about this for seniors is that kids can take it with them when they go to college. There is something special about a senior portrait session. Marking the milestone of the year and changes about to come will be something they never experience again.

I invite all of my inquiring clients to come to the studio for a pre-consult. This way, they can see the things we offer and we can plan their session accordingly to what they want in the end. You won’t find that at your box studios!
